build platform rotation vs powder bed

could we not achieve overhang by shifting the build platform at an angle? You would need to still be able to reach the target area under that angle but moving build platforms have been done and why not tilting build platforms? how much overhang can currently be achieved without supports? 90 degrees - current angle is the angel we'd need to be able to tilt the build platform by.

Is that a viable alternative to a powder bed. A powder bed has the disadvantage of not being able to incorporate enclosed spaces or porous materials. A lot of powder may also be lost during the freeing of the part from the bed. --Robinmdh 14:43, 18 March 2011 (UTC)
